I normally DON'T WRITE REVIEWS, but all the negative reviews caused me to write one because I think the poor reviews were an unfair evaluation of this product. When I first turned on the pointer I was pleasantly pleased it seemed fully charged but couldn't figure out the bizarre pattern of multi-light points when I was expecting a single beam of light. However, I soon realized I had to unscrew the end cover and remove it to get a single beam. I can't imagine an application for the multi-light option. I was amazed how bright it was and was puzzled at the many reviews that said it had a dim beam of light. The second thing I noticed was that the beam point was not real sharp. Instead it was about 4x larger than my previous pointers beam point at about 20 feet away. Again, I was surprised at the poor reviews on this because for "my" application of pointing it toward a PowerPoint screen about 10 ft away, it was ideal. My previous pointer was so sharp and fine that my audience had a hard time seeing it. I agree that the beams point is a little blurry but I see this as good because the point of light from this pointer would be larger and therefore easier for my audience to see what I was pointing at. I also like that it is rechargable instead of powered by batteries. The only concern may be that it did not come with the plug and the cable requires the older USB style power plug rather than the newer and smaller end that my iphone 13 uses. Fortunately I had several of my older plugs lying around so that was not a concern for me. I like that the power button is on the side rather than on the end like my old pointer and that it does not click "on" and "off" but rather you must hold it down while using it. This fits my use better because it automatically turns off when I take my thumb off the button. I also was puzzled at the plastic piece over the power button when I received it as I tried to figure out if I should leave it in place or take it off and keep it in the box just in case. I finally realized it was for shipping and was to protect the power button from being depressed during shipping so the pointer would arrive ready to use. I have yet to use it for a presentation but shining it around the house convinces me that I will really enjoy using this pointer. I did not look at the age of the other reviews and it might be the company rectified the intensity of the beam and I benefited from previous poor reviews. I hate to admit that I looked for an instruction sheet to figure some of this stuff out, but there was none :) Most people probably wouldn't need one but it did take me a little thinking to figure these things out. Overall, I think I will really enjoy this pointer.

I purchased this with some qualms, but this was the best choice for what I was looking for. I prefer my pointers to be rechargeable because finding replacement batteries can be a pain for me. I would have preferred USB c as higher tech is nudging me away from USB a style options in my house.One of the more notable downsides of this laser pointer is that the dot isn’t as focused as I’ve seen in other pointers in the past—it’s less dot and more circle, no matter how I try to adjust it. Other reviews talk about how dim it is, and in some ways I agree. This is basically a black light laser pointer, so what you’re pointing at makes a difference…if you aim it at something that will fluoresce under black light, it is literally like night and day. So it does its job, just not how you’d expect compared to other laser pointers.Now let’s talk about the overall quality of the device. This one has a plastic body so it doesn’t feel as substantial as I’m used to. The rest of it seems to be fine though—everything is lined up, the screw pieces seem to work well, it’s just…well…plastic.

The light color is light blue, not purple.The beam strength is very weak, and difficult to see on most any surface other than bleached white paper. Even white paint does not reflect much of it.The pattern lens mounted to the front makes everything seem blurry unlike other brands of lasers.There is no way this should be called long range.The charge port on this is made a very tight tolerance, and it is difficult to plug in the cable that is included. Also, the charge port is older, micro USB, which is fairly rare these days and means keeping an extra cord around. Lastly, the socket is very flexible and loose. It feels like it may be connected only on the data pins and not on the structure/ground pins.Overall, this is poor quality and massively overpriced for what it is.
